别再纸上谈兵手把手带你跑通区块链应用

作者:枣强文明网 2026-04-29 浏览:6
导读: 好多人研习区块链,仅盯着理论瞧得脑袋晕眩,然而连一个最为简易的DApp都安置不出来;这恰似背诵了十年游泳口诀,一下水依旧会被呛到 ; 切实要把控区块。...

好多人研习区块链,仅盯着理论瞧得脑袋晕眩,然而连一个最为简易的DApp都安置不出来;这恰似背诵了十年游泳口诀,一下水依旧会被呛到 ; 切实要把控区块。这套视频流程的关键就是借由一堆真实项目,引领你自搭建环境乃至编写合约,再至上线调整,每一步骤都能瞧见摸到。

区块链应用开发难吗

首先表明结论:槛的确是存在的,然而并非那般高。难点并非在于智能合约语法,而是在于对去中心化思维模式的理解。就似一个投票系统,仅传统的数据库更改字段便可以做到,而在区块链上却需要思量Gas费、交易确认跟事件监听。在我的视频里会将各个难点拆解成时长为5分钟的小节,以便让你在观看的过程当中边看边进行操作,跟随其完整运行一遍便会知晓其中的门道处在何处。

如何选择合适的开发框架

新手极易在选择工具这个方面遭遇阻碍。运用Remix来练习操作是最为迅速的,然而若真打算进行实际应用,那就必须得用到Hardhat或者Foundry才行。我录制了三个用来对比的案例,针对同一个存证合约,分别借助三种不同的框架去予以实现。你将会目睹Hardhat的调试功能究竟是怎样在“交易回滚”的可怕情形下拯救你的,Foundry的模糊测试又是以何种方式自动找出漏洞的。一旦选对了框架,开发效率起码能够实现翻倍。

别再纸上谈兵手把手带你跑通区块链应用

实战案例能学到什么

一个全流程跟着代码,从需求分析一直到上线维护的完整“链上积分商城”项目示例在教程中存在。讲大道理而不付诸实际行动那是假把式,你会知晓怎样去设计其中可实现升级的合约,怎样运用Merkle Tree来发放白名单,怎样于前端借助Web3.js去调用合约。更为关键的是,我会模拟一回“合约遭受攻击”的情景,亲自带着你去打补丁——这般经验即便阅读再多文档也是无法学到的。

视频教程的优势在哪

观看书籍或者文字教程之际,你时常会因版本存在差异而陷入困境。然而视频之中,每一项操作步骤,每一条报错信息,都能够清晰明了地加以查看。打个比方,当部署至测试网过程里遭遇nonce too low错误之时,我会于现场呈现排查的思路:对pending交易展开查询,将nonce计数器予以重置,再次进行签名操作。这样一种临场的感觉,乃是文字所不能够替代的。你依照此去亲自做上一回,往后碰到相似问题便能够自行予以解决

你看完这一篇之后,心中可存在着最想要率先运用区块链去解决的实际问题?欢迎于评论区域分享你的想法,点赞数量高的那些,我会予以考量加录一期具有针对性的案例。要是这一套教程助力你成功运行起第一个应用,可别忘了分享给同样处于门口迟疑、不肯轻易前进的朋友。

转载请注明出处:枣强文明网,如有疑问,请联系()。
本文地址:https://m.zqwxw.com/imqb/6151.html

添加回复: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。